【JS提升】IE常见的BUG解决方案

一、IE常见的BUG解决方案

(1)IE6常见BUG

  1. 盒子浮动的margin会变成2倍,解决方案 => display: inline / block
  2. 元素浮动会有3个像素间隙,解决方案 => 都加float
  3. 外部一个盒子相对定位,内部一个盒子绝对定位,如果right/left/top/bottom = 0,会有1px间隙,解决方案 => 设置偶数宽高
  4. img 下方有白色间隙,解决方案 => block、vertical-align、font-size: 0(不建议)
  5. 一个空元素,如果设置 0 - 19 像素的高度,会默认设置19像素高度,解决方案 => overflow: hidden、 、font-size: 0
  6. 浮动元素清除浮动的时候一些文字会跑到下面,解决方案 => 一行所有元素加上inline、margin-right给负值
  7. z-index失效,解决方案 => 父级position:relative、z-index: 1
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值